Summary

A school in Ohio has expanded its Newark Electrical Apprenticeship program to address the growing demand for electricians. This initiative reflects a proactive approach to ensure that the workforce is equipped with the necessary skills to meet industry needs.

As the demand for skilled trades continues to rise, apprenticeship programs like this one play a crucial role in developing the next generation of professionals. They provide earn-and-learn opportunities that not only help individuals gain valuable experience but also contribute to the overall strength of the workforce in key sectors.

Why this matters for apprenticeships

This story highlights the essential role of registered apprenticeship programs in bridging the skills gap in the electrical trade. By expanding access to training, these initiatives help to create sustainable career pathways for aspiring electricians and strengthen the overall labor market.
